How Does the Brewing Process Differ in Digital Coffee Machines?
The brewing process differs in digital coffee machines through automation and precision. Digital machines use electronic controls to regulate temperature, pressure, and brewing time. This leads to consistent brewing results with minimal user intervention.
Digital coffee machines typically feature programmable settings. Users can set the desired brew strength and temperature. Many also allow for scheduling brews in advance. This flexibility enhances convenience compared to traditional brewing methods, which usually require manual adjustments.
The heating element in digital machines heats water to a precise temperature. This ensures optimal extraction of flavors from the coffee grounds. Traditional methods may rely on less accurate heating, leading to variable results.
Additionally, digital coffee machines often include built-in grinders. This function grinds coffee beans freshly before brewing. Freshly ground coffee usually results in a more flavorful cup.
Lastly, many digital machines have display screens. These screens provide real-time information about the brewing process. Users can monitor the status of their brew easily.
Overall, digital coffee machines offer enhanced precision, convenience, and control during the brewing process.

How Can You Ensure Proper Maintenance and Cleaning of Your Digital Coffee Machine?
To ensure proper maintenance and cleaning of your digital coffee machine, regularly follow a cleaning schedule, use the right cleaning products, and address specific components such as the water reservoir and brew group.
Regular cleaning schedule: Set a routine to clean your coffee machine. Studies show that machines cleaned every 1 to 3 months produce better-tasting coffee and function more efficiently (Coffee Research Institute, 2021).
Use appropriate cleaning products: Always use cleaning solutions designed for coffee machines. For example, many manufacturers recommend using descaling solutions to remove mineral buildup. This is important because hard water can lead to machine malfunctions over time.
Clean the water reservoir: Empty and wash the water reservoir with warm, soapy water at least once a week. Avoid using abrasive materials that could scratch the surface.
Maintain the brew group: If your machine has a removable brew group, take it out and rinse it under warm water every week. This prevents coffee oils from accumulating, which can affect flavor and functionality.
Inspect and clean the drip tray: Regularly check the drip tray for overflow. Empty and clean it weekly to prevent odors and bacteria from developing.
Replace filters: Change water filters as specified by the manufacturer. A study from the Specialty Coffee Association (2022) highlights that fresh filters improve coffee quality by removing impurities.
Follow user manual guidelines: Always refer to the user manual for specific cleaning instructions tailored to your model. Manuals often provide crucial information on parts that require special attention.
By adhering to these practices, you can prolong the life of your coffee machine and maintain the quality of the coffee it produces.
